American Savings Bank appoints John Jacobi as Executive VP and Chief Information Officer

American Savings Bank has named John Jacobi as Executive Vice President and Chief Information Officer. John will oversee ASB’s technology teams and lead strategic initiatives, continuing ASB’s commitment to providing its customers with best-in-class service. John most recently served as CIO for Hawaiian Airlines.

American Savings Bank awards $135K to aspiring keiki entrepreneurs

American Savings Bank awarded $135,000 to nine winning student teams as part of its seventh annual Bank for Education KeikiCo Business Plan Competition. Students in grades 3 through 12 submitted business plans for ideas that support Hawaiʻi’s resilience and growth, including sustainable bedding for the homeless and a device that prevents dehydration.

Independent investors acquire non-controlling interests in American Savings Bank

Independent investors have acquired non-controlling interests in American Savings Bank in separate transactions from Hawaiian Electric Industries Inc., the bank announced today. Among other things, HEI said the sale will give it flexibility in making its Maui wildfire settlement contributions.
